Intertextile Shanghai Apparel Fabrics –March’24

What have been the major changes in market over the years?

Bruno Landi, Vitale Barberis Canonico, Italy
Bruno LandiThe major changes in the China market over the years have included a shift from buying high-quality, high-priced products to more price- conscious options, a transition from formal wear to leisure and outdoor products, and a slowdown in the market due to economic challenges such as high unemployment rates and real estate issues. Additionally, there has been a shift towards functional leisure products, with a small percentage of formal production transitioning to this new trend.”
Bob McAuley, President, HMS International
Bob McAuleyThe emerging trends in products around the world include a shift towards heavier fabrics, a preference for casual and performance fabrics with stretch, and a focus on more casual and sportswear options. Additionally, there is a trend towards more women's wear tailored clothing and a demand for heavier fabrics in many countries.”
Takashi Mitani, General Manager, Kurabo Textiles, Japan
Takashi MitaniThe world of textiles is changing in terms of focus on ecology and sustainability, with advanced markets like the USA and Europe leading the way. Japanese companies are also trying to promote ecology and sustainability, especially as they enter the China market. Additionally, there is a shift towards using Japanese technical expertise in production facilities in countries like Thailand, Vietnam, Indonesia and China. ”
